Ricki Lamie (born 26 June 1993) is a Scottish professional footballer who plays as a defender for Greenock Morton.
He has previously played for Airdrieonians, Queen's Park and loan spells at East Stirlingshire, Bathgate Thistle and Clyde.
Lamie started his senior career when he moved to Airdrieonians (then called Airdrie United) in 2011 from his youth team Whitburn Boys Club. In his first season with Airdrie's youth team, he won the club's U19 Player of the Year award.
Whilst at Airdrie he had three loan spells at Bathgate Thistle,Clyde and East Stirlingshire.
In the summer of 2014, Lamie signed up with Morton on a short-term contract. This was extended in January, and he signed on against for the 2015–16 season in May 2015.
His contract was again extended in May 2016, this time for one year. After a successful campaign in 2016-17, Lamie signed up for another season.
